What is a Fabrication Centre?

A fabrication centre is a specialized facility where various materials, such as metal, wood, concrete, and other components, are processed and assembled into pre-fabricated elements used in construction projects. These centres use advanced machinery, skilled labor, and cutting-edge technology to create components such as steel beams, frames, structural supports, and other building materials with high precision. Fabrication centres streamline the construction process by providing ready-made components that can be quickly installed on-site, minimizing delays and reducing labor costs.

The Role of the Fabrication Centre at Nirman Estate

1. Efficiency in Construction

One of the most significant advantages of having a fabrication centre on-site at Nirman Estate is the dramatic improvement in construction efficiency. By pre-fabricating major components such as steel frames, panels, and structural elements, the fabrication centre reduces the time required for assembly on-site. Traditional construction methods often involve assembling materials on-site, leading to delays due to weather conditions, labor shortages, or other unforeseen issues. With a fabrication centre, these challenges are mitigated because most of the heavy lifting is done off-site.

2. Cost-Effectiveness

The pre-fabrication process is also more cost-effective. Fabricating materials in a controlled environment allows for better resource management, minimizing material waste and reducing the likelihood of errors during the construction phase. Additionally, having a fabrication centre within the estate reduces transportation costs associated with sourcing materials from external suppliers. With the ability to source materials locally and process them on-site, Nirman Estate benefits from significant cost savings that can be passed on to homeowners or businesses within the estate.

3. Precision and Quality Control

The fabrication centre at Nirman Estate ensures a level of precision and quality control that is difficult to achieve with traditional construction methods. By using advanced machinery and highly skilled workers, each component is manufactured to exact specifications, reducing the potential for defects or inconsistencies in the final structure. The controlled environment of the fabrication centre allows for better monitoring of quality throughout the process, ensuring that all components meet the required standards before they are delivered to the construction site.

4. Sustainability and Waste Reduction

Sustainability is at the forefront of modern construction practices, and the fabrication centre at Nirman Estate aligns with these principles by focusing on minimizing waste and maximizing material efficiency. The precision involved in pre-fabricating materials ensures that fewer resources are wasted during the construction process. Additionally, the centre can recycle scrap materials and repurpose them for other projects, further reducing the estate’s environmental impact. The use of energy-efficient machinery and sustainable materials also contributes to the eco-friendly nature of the development.

5. Customization and Flexibility

Another key advantage of a fabrication centre is the ability to customize materials and components to meet the specific needs of the estate. Whether it’s designing unique architectural features, incorporating sustainable materials, or adhering to specific regulatory requirements, the fabrication centre offers the flexibility to tailor components to the project’s requirements. This ability to customize allows Nirman Estate to stand out in the market, offering innovative and unique features that differentiate it from other developments.

6. Streamlined Project Management

With a fabrication centre on-site, project management becomes more streamlined and organized. The coordination between the design, fabrication, and construction teams is simplified, reducing the chances of miscommunication or delays. Since components are produced ahead of time and delivered to the site as needed, there is less downtime for workers waiting for materials. This synchronization helps to keep the construction process moving smoothly, ensuring that deadlines are met and that the project remains within budget.

7. Safety and Labor Efficiency

The controlled environment of the fabrication centre also enhances safety on the construction site. By moving much of the heavy and dangerous work to the fabrication centre, workers on-site are less exposed to the risks associated with traditional construction activities. The use of advanced tools and machinery further reduces the chances of human error, leading to a safer working environment. Additionally, by requiring fewer laborers on-site, the risk of injuries or accidents is minimized, contributing to a safer and more efficient construction process.

The Functioning of a Wholesale Sabji Mandi NKKN Farmers and Suppliers Farmers are the primary suppliers in a wholesale vegetable market. They bring their produce directly or through intermediaries, such as commission agents or wholesalers. The majority of vegetables and fruits are sourced from nearby villages or agricultural hubs. Some high-demand items may come from distant states or even imported from other countries. Commission Agents (Arthiyas) Commission agents, also known as “Arthiyas,” act as middlemen between farmers and wholesale buyers. They charge a commission (usually a percentage of the sale price) for facilitating transactions. These agents often have long-term relationships with farmers and buyers, ensuring a smooth flow of goods. Wholesalers Wholesalers purchase large quantities of vegetables and fruits from farmers or commission agents. They further sell these goods in bulk to retailers, institutional buyers, and food processing companies. Wholesalers play a crucial role in stabilizing supply and demand by managing inventory efficiently. Retailers and Vendors Retailers, including local vegetable vendors, supermarkets, and online grocery platforms, buy from wholesalers and sell directly to consumers. Some retailers visit the Sabji Mandi early in the morning to pick the freshest produce at competitive prices. Pricing Mechanism Prices in a wholesale Sabji Mandi are determined by various factors, including: Supply and Demand: Seasonal fluctuations and weather conditions affect availability and pricing. Quality of Produce: Freshness, size, and overall quality determine the price of vegetables. Market Trends: Prices may rise or fall based on overall demand in the region. Government Regulations: Minimum Support Prices (MSP) and market regulations impact wholesale rates. Bargaining and Auctions: In some mandis, open auctions decide the final selling price of vegetables and fruits. Challenges Faced by Wholesale Sabji Mandi Despite their importance, wholesale Sabji Mandis face several challenges: Middlemen Exploitation Farmers often receive low prices due to the presence of multiple intermediaries, reducing their profit margins. While middlemen provide financial support to farmers, they also control pricing in a way that benefits them more than the farmers. Lack of Infrastructure Many wholesale markets suffer from inadequate infrastructure, such as poor roads, lack of cold storage, unhygienic conditions, and improper waste management. These issues lead to spoilage and wastage of produce. Price Fluctuations Vegetable prices are highly volatile due to unpredictable weather, pest attacks, or disruptions in transportation. These fluctuations impact farmers’ earnings and consumer affordability. Inefficiencies in Transportation Timely transportation is essential for perishable goods. However, poor road conditions, traffic congestion, and lack of proper logistics result in delays, causing losses due to spoilage. Government Regulations and Bureaucracy The Agricultural Produce Market Committee (APMC) laws regulate the functioning of wholesale Sabji Mandis. While these laws protect farmers, they also introduce bureaucratic hurdles, leading to corruption and inefficiencies. Competition from Supermarkets and Online Platforms With the rise of online grocery platforms and supermarkets, traditional wholesale markets face stiff competition. Many urban consumers prefer home delivery services, reducing footfall in physical mandis. Modernization and Digital Transformation in Sabji Mandis To address these challenges, governments and private players are working on modernizing wholesale vegetable markets. Some key developments include: E-NAM (Electronic National Agriculture Market) E-NAM is an online trading platform that connects farmers directly with buyers, reducing dependency on middlemen. It ensures transparency in pricing and improves market access for small-scale farmers. Cold Storage and Warehousing To minimize post-harvest losses, investments are being made in cold storage and modern warehousing facilities. This helps in preserving perishable goods for longer periods. Better Logistics and Transportation Governments and private companies are investing in better roads, transportation networks, and supply chain management systems to improve the efficiency of wholesale markets. Smart Mandis Some states are implementing smart mandi models with digital payment systems, CCTV surveillance, waste management solutions, and real-time price tracking to improve efficiency. Direct-to-Consumer Platforms Startups and farmer-producer organizations (FPOs) are launching platforms where farmers can sell directly to consumers, supermarkets, and restaurants, bypassing middlemen.
